LOVELY DAUGHTER
Artwork by Amy Irvine
My toddler has a small pink bike
And shorts adorned with kittens
A blue raincoat with tractors on
A pair of teddy mittens
A pair of chubby cheeks and all
Where mud is always smeared
Or chocolate spread or glitter-glue
And blood and snot and tears
Long blonde hair that knots itself
However much you brush
A sunny disposition
And a tendency to rush
Play-fighting and singalongs
Are staples day to day
And cuddles too, and talk of poo
Is never far away
Charming everywhere they go
And almost everyone
Says, “You have a lovely daughter”
Not, “You have a lovely son”
To which I reply, “Thank you”
